Output 90c590bf6f4c67e27537d9ce98af25ef282912a8d124391c101825a33ca76348:0

value
74950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 006b9dcb41ebc018a9728786dbb76a72d9c6b674 OP_EQUAL
address
31jEqru2jJKqv2vgDr7hCFxXVLTvo7Ve7z
transaction
90c590bf6f4c67e27537d9ce98af25ef282912a8d124391c101825a33ca76348
spent
true